Dynamics of Heparin Translocations Through Solid‐State Nanopores
Carbohydrates can be detected with solid‐state nanopores, but their kinetics of voltage‐driven passage are fast. To better understand the dynamics of passage of these biomolecules and the role of electrophoresis and electroosmosis, we studied the translocation characteristics of heparin as a function of salt concentration, pH and voltage polarity ...

Hybrid SiOₓ‐CVD/PDMS ultrathin films mitigate atmospheric corrosion of additively manufactured AlSi10Mg. Electrochemical analyses show reduced corrosion currents, increased charge‐transfer resistance, and suppressed pitting due to diminished cathodic activity and limited oxygen and ion transport under NaCl exposure.

Approximation theorems for modified Szasz-Mirakjan operators in polynomial weight spaces
In this paper we will study properties of Szasz-Mirakjan type operators A_n^ν , B_n^ ν defined by modified Bessel function I_ν . We shall present theorems giving a degree of approximation for these operators.
